WebThe American Academy of Pediatrics (AAP) recommends that babies and toddlers take a nap for at least 1-hour daily. AAP recommends napping for 30 minutes every two hours or less for preschool-aged kids, while older kids can nap for up to two hours. Napping time is an integral part of a healthy sleep routine for kids. WebMar 29, 2024 · 1. The Power Nap. The best length of time for a power nap is 10 to 20 minutes. During a power nap, you remain in the first stage of your sleeping. After a perfect duration of light sleeping, you wake up feeling refreshed and energetic. 2. 30 Minute Nap. After 30 minutes of sleeping, you enter stage two.
